HGL Dynamics

Who are we? What do we do?

HGL Designs, Manufactures and Supports Sensor to ReportMeasurement Systems
primarily for Rotating Machinery applications across the Globe.

We provide customers with the capability to Acquire, Monitor, Analyse and Report on almost any analogue signal from simple handheld low-channel count devices through to hundreds of diverse signals within a large development test bed.

The company focuses on rotating machinery such as Gas, Steam and Wind Turbines, Gearboxes, and Generators but we also provides systems and solutions for Rocket Engines, Oil and Gas, Railway, Playground Safety and long-term Conditioning Monitoring in many Application areas.

HGL prides itself on developing and manufacturing all of its own Hardware, Firmward and Software in-house primarily in its UK and US facilities. This brings security, continuity and deep knowledge of our solutions and their application.

HGL has a proven range of standard Hardware and Software Products, but is very open to developing customised solutions or new products with its customers and partners.

Our Story

HGL Dynamics Limited was founded in Godalming UK in 2000 by Dr Jim Hone, Dr Andy Law and Emma Hone with the aim of developing leading edge Data Acquisition, Monitoring, Analysis and Data Management systems specifically for the Aero Gas Turbine Industry. The founders both had several years experience of providing Data Acquisition and Analysis systems within this sector and also within the defence and transport sectors prior to founding HGL Dynamics.

The company started as a software-centric organisation utilising 3rd party hardware, but quickly started developing its own PC solutions for hosting the software, and then moved into development of its own rugged and modular Data Acquisition Front Ends which have become the mainstay of the company and are sold globally to a wide range of customers in multiple industries.

The company has grown since 2000 from the original three founders to 45+ across a group of five independent companies in Europe (UK, France and Germany), The United States, and South Korea with a number of partner companies and long-term distributors across the globe.

Whilst primarily focused on Dynamic (1kHz - 100kHz bandwidth) Data Acquisition and Analysis, the company has more recently expanded into Steady State (1Hz - 1kHz) and High-Speed (100kHz - 10MHz) including Blade Tip Clearance (BTC) and Blade Tip Timing (BTT) applications.

All of our hardware solutions are supported by in-house developed Firmware and Software providing a true one-stop shop for Measurement Applications from “DC to Light".

Our original operational scope was tightly focused on the Aero Gas Turbine market with Rolls-Royce an early (and continuing) customer, and whilst this remains a substantial part of the business with Safran, ACAE, and Pratt and Whitney (amongst others), the company also diversified out to other industries including Industrial Gas Turbines, Wind Turbines, Marine, Railway and Oil & Gas markets.

In 2010 HGL Dynamics onboarded all its own hardware design & manufacture, and today our Lincoln (UK) facility operates modern, flexible PCB Surface Mount Assembly, Mechanical Machine Shops and System Build and Repair operations. Our Indianapolis (US) Facility can also design and manufacture mechanical items and supports a full Support and Service function. The company also undertakes design, manufacture and testing operations for 3rd party customers in a wide array of applications via our HGL Systems operating division.

HGL Dynamics also has a long history of providing onsite Test Support services for its customers and In 2021 this was strengthened to include Test Campaign Planning and Measurement Uncertainty services when we launched our German operation (Ertemes GmbH) in Berlin.
